Steps to Break the Wind Barrier
Breaking the wind barrier in Dragonspine involves finding and using Scarlet Quartz. These are special, glowing red stones scattered around the Dragonspine area.
First, locate a Scarlet Quartz nearby. Once you find one, attack it to collect its power. You’ll notice your character glows with a red aura. Next, approach the wind barrier while the aura is still active, and attack it. The barrier will shatter, allowing you to pass through. Remember, the effect of the Scarlet Quartz wears off after a short time, so be quick!
